Michael Saylor, the chairman of Strategy (NASDAQ: MSTR), has published a new essay on X explaining his bold views on money, Bitcoin, and the future of the economy. 

He argues that money is essentially “economic energy” and that Bitcoin is the best technology to store that energy.

Is money economic energy? 

In an essay titled “What Is Money?” written by Michael Saylor, the chairman of Strategy, and Robert Breedlove, money is defined as the technology that lets people store the value of their labor, move it forward in time, and send it across distance. 

Saylor’s phrase for that value is “economic energy,” and within his essay, he asks a single question: how effectively does any monetary system conserve it?

He explains that “good money” should let you store the value of your work, move it forward in time, and send it across long distances without experiencing “monetary entropy,” which is a loss of value. 

Saylor wrote that gold, as a store of value, earns points for its scarcity and durability, but it is also heavy, costly to move, costly to secure and audit, and is dependent on custodians once it enters the financial system, making it mechanically defective. 

Government-issued money does not have gold’s portability problem, but it hands control of supply and rules to governments and central banks.

In the essay, Bitcoin is described as a digital monetary energy. It has no physical mass, no central issuer, and a supply fixed at 21 million coins. 

What does Elon Musk think about money? 

Prior to Saylor publishing his essay, there was an ongoing conversation about what an AI-driven economy does to money. 

Elon Musk has predicted that artificial intelligence will make goods abundant and eventually render money irrelevant through what he calls a universal high income. 

Saylor pushed back on that view in a Diary of a CEO interview with host Steven Bartlett, published earlier this month, telling Bartlett that people will always chase scarce, status-conferring goods because “we’re status-oriented animals.”

Strategy currently holds 840,447 BTC, the largest disclosed corporate stack. The company has been a net seller of BTC in recent months, offloading 1,690 Bitcoin for about $108.6 million in early August to buy back its STRC preferred shares, per Cryptopolitan’s reporting

The company’s CEO, Phong Le, has stated that Strategy expects to resume buying before year-end.
